Q: The restock planner (StockHopper) generated an empty route — what now?

A: Empty routes usually mean the telemetry sync from the machines failed overnight, so the planner thinks every slot is full. Check the sync job's last success time first. If it's older than 12 hours, rerun the sync, then regenerate the route — do not hand-edit routes, drivers' apps will desync. If the sync is healthy but routes are still empty, escalate to the Brindlevale planning team. Diagnostic queries and the escalation rota are on the page below.

runbook for taduf-kawef: https://confluence.qorvelsys.internal/projects/display/display/pages

Alert: VRAM-PROFILER-STALL. This fires when the Gravelight GPU memory profiler fails to flush samples for more than ten minutes on any training node. It usually means the profiling daemon crashed or the shared memory ring buffer filled up. As a contractor, do not restart training jobs yourself — just restart the gravelight-agent service and confirm samples resume in the dashboard. If the alert persists after one restart, hand it off to the tooling team at this address.

escalation mailbox, yafog-kafof: eliok@xolmarcloud.local

## Encoding Detection

Hey plugin authors — when files land in Pindlewick, we sniff encoding before your hooks run. We try UTF-8 first, fall back to a byte-frequency heuristic, and tag the result in metadata, so don't re-detect in your plugin. If detection fails, the file is quarantined and your hook never fires. Plugins must be submitted as signed bundles, and the signing key you'll verify against is listed below.

release key, fajef-kajeg: bky19_LdLu6Ne6FLi8he2c24d

## v4.3.0 — TilePress cache layer

Introduced LRU eviction with configurable memory ceilings per zoom level, replacing the fixed-size ring buffer. Cold-start warming now pre-fetches the nine most recently viewed tiles. Verified no regression in the Dunmarle benchmark suite; eviction metrics are exported for dashboards. Safe to include in the Thursday cut pending sign-off. Owner for this change is listed below.

signatory, yagap-bawig: Ulaath Eliath